30-Minute Ground Turkey Tacos

These 30-minute ground turkey tacos are a quick and easy weeknight dinner made with seasoned lean turkey and fresh toppings. They’re lighter than traditional tacos while still being flavorful and satisfying.

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ground turkey
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 small onion diced
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
  • cup water
  • 8 small tortillas
  • Shredded lettuce for serving
  • Diced tomatoes for serving
  • Shredded cheese for serving
  • Sour cream or salsa optional

Instructions

  •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Add the diced onion and cook for 2–3 minutes until softened.
  • Add the ground turkey and cook until browned, breaking it up as it cooks.
  • Stir in the gar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.
  • Add taco seasoning and water, then simmer for 5 minutes until thickened.
  • Warm the tortillas and fill with the seasoned ground turkey.
  • Serve with lettuce, tomatoes, cheese, and your favorite toppings.

Notes

For extra flavor, add a squeeze of lime juice or a pinch of chili powder to the turkey mixture. Leftover filling works well for taco bowls or salads.
